How To Fix CNV20200621 - Table &1 excluded from the conversion; execute activity in edit mode


CNV20200621 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CNV20200 - Messages for development class CNV_20200

  • Message number: 621

  • Message text: Table &1 excluded from the conversion; execute activity in edit mode

CNV20200621 - Details

  • The SAP error message CNV20200621 indicates that a specific table (denoted as &1) has been excluded from the conversion process, and it suggests that you need to execute the activity in edit mode to address the issue. This error typically arises during data migration or conversion activities, particularly when using SAP's Conversion Tools or Migration Cockpit.
    
    Cause: Table Exclusion: The table in question has been marked for exclusion from the conversion process. This could be due to various reasons, such as: The table is not relevant for the conversion. The table contains data that is not compatible with the target system. The table has been manually excluded by a user or through configuration settings. Execution Mode: The error suggests that the activity needs to be executed in edit mode, which implies that the current execution mode is likely set to display or read-only.
